2011 Dissertation Award

Wednesday, February 2, 2011

 

Dr. Panichpapiboon received the 2011 Dissertation Award from the National Research Council of Thailand (NRCT), in recognition of his doctoral dissertation entitled “Practical Design Issues in Ad Hoc Wireless Networks: Transmit Power, Topology, and Routing”. The award was presented to him by His Excellency Mr. Abhisit Vejjajiva, Prime Minister of the Kingdom of Thailand, on February 2, 2011. Dr. Panichpapiboon’s dissertation investigated on the fundamental design issues in ad hoc wireless networks. It helped a network designer make a proper decision on: how to choose an optimal power, how to choose a right topology, and how to select a proper routing strategy. His dissertation was supervised by Prof. Ozan Tonguz of Carnegie Mellon University.
